AquaC EV-240

Does anyone have spare injectors for this skimmer? Or know where I could find one?? I just bought one and broke the injector.... The company literally went out of business last month

If you did not completely shatter it you should be able to superglue it. I remember seeing a video on youtube a while back on a diy injector nozzle. I actually went to their warehouse in San Diego last year to get a nozzle and it seemed the owner disnt care about his business as the phone rang non stop and he had told the employee to not answer. The place was full of skimmers and parts. Very good skimmer just terrible customer service.
